I've been looking over the Able 7 features pretty thoroughly, and I can't find anything about PABP certification with Able 7.
There are several PABP programs from the differen't credit card companies, Verified by Visa, MasterCard 3-D SecureCode and JCB's J/Secure. This is the very important part: If you choose a NON PABP certified shopping cart platform, your business could be shut down by VISA in 2008. Visa seems to be leading the pack on this one, but I'm sure the other credit card companies with be following shortly as well. They might have already, I'm just not aware of it if they have.
So without knowing if Able 7 is PCI and PABP compliant and certified it would give me great pause about buying it. Has Able 7 been certified for PABP and PCI compliance with all the card companies?
